黑马程序员--小结asp.net中get、post用法区别

------- Windows Phone 7手机开发、.Net培训、期待与您交流! -------  
 
  1. Post:只能用于动态页面处理数据,静态页面中无法使用!(服务器解析会报错)
 
  1. 两种方式传值:get、post的用法区别:
get ---:string strName=context.Request.QueryString["txName"];//get方式提交的通过QueryString获取;
截取浏览器中套接字信息:
黑马程序员--小结asp.net中get、post用法区别
post---:string strSub = context.Request.Form["txName"];//post提交的通过Request.Form获取;参数存在于请求报文体中:
截取浏览器中套接字信息:
黑马程序员--小结asp.net中get、post用法区别
 
get方式场景:一种通过浏览器地址栏的url来提交【1.直接在浏览器后面加入;2.使用超链接;3.通过js实现】(如:跳转),另一种通过form表单的method=get。
 
post方式场景:通过form表单的method=post
以上分析了get、post的却别,现在小结其使用: 
什么时候使用POST,什么时候使用GET?
可以根据语义来区分:
POST:当浏览器将用户数据传至服务器保存时(如:注册、保存文章等);
GET:当浏览器为了获取服务器的某段数据时(如:文章详细页面,分页等)
 
 
Response和Request:
黑马程序员--小结asp.net中get、post用法区别

 
黑马程序员--小结asp.net中get、post用法区别
 
------- Windows Phone 7手机开发、.Net培训、期待与您交流! -------
 

网站标题:黑马程序员--小结asp.net中get、post用法区别
文章链接:http://bzwzjz.com/article/gdseig.html

其他资讯

Copyright © 2007-2020 广东宝晨空调科技有限公司 All Rights Reserved 粤ICP备2022107769号
友情链接: 成都网站设计 成都网站建设 成都网站制作 成都网站设计 移动手机网站制作 手机网站制作设计 营销网站建设 企业网站设计 LED网站设计方案 成都模版网站建设 成都营销网站建设 成都网站建设 专业网站设计 网站建设方案 成都网站设计制作公司 成都网站建设 成都网站制作 成都网站建设 H5网站制作 重庆网站制作 成都网站建设公司 网站建设费用